Etymology

From ansero (goose) +‎ haŭto (skin), probably a calque of German Gänsehaut.

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/anserˈhawto/
  • Audio:(file)
  • Hyphenation: an‧ser‧haŭ‧to

Noun

anserhaŭto (accusative singular anserhaŭton, plural anserhaŭtoj, accusative plural anserhaŭtojn)

  1. goose bumps, goose flesh, goose pimples (raised skin, usually caused by the involuntary erection of hairs on the neck or arms caused by cold, excitement, or fear).
    Ŝi havis anserhaŭton pro la malvarmo.
    She had goose bumps because of the cold.
